Welcome to mirror list, hosted at ThFree Co, Russian Federation.

gitlab.com/gitlab-org/gitlab-foss.git - Unnamed repository; edit this file 'description' to name the repository.
summ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orFatih Acet <acetfatih@gmail.com>2017-12-01 18:18:59 +0300
committerFatih Acet <acetfatih@gmail.com>2017-12-04 23:12:35 +0300
commitde3eabc5bf530dd95dafa77efc006c163aa6b1f0 (patch)
tree3540e85cb5990501952cb7807d3d2bcbc06b8608 /spec/features/merge_requests
parentf3a3bd50eafdcfcaeea21d6cfa0b8bbae7720fec (diff)
Fix loading branches list on cherry pick modal after merge.
Diffstat (limited to 'spec/features/merge_requests')
-rw-r--r--spec/features/merge_requests/widget_spec.rb12
1 files changed, 12 insertions, 0 deletions
diff --git a/spec/features/merge_requests/widget_spec.rb b/spec/features/merge_requests/widget_spec.rb
index 2bad3b02250..3ee094c216e 100644
--- a/spec/features/merge_requests/widget_spec.rb
+++ b/spec/features/merge_requests/widget_spec.rb
@@ -63,6 +63,18 @@ describe 'Merge request', :js do
expect(page).to have_selector('.accept-merge-request')
expect(find('.accept-merge-request')['disabled']).not_to be(true)
end
+
+ it 'allows me to merge, see cherry-pick modal and load branches list' do
+ wait_for_requests
+ click_button 'Merge'
+
+ wait_for_requests
+ click_link 'Cherry-pick'
+ page.find('.js-project-refs-dropdown').click
+ wait_for_requests
+
+ expect(page.all('.js-cherry-pick-form .dropdown-content li').size).to be > 1
+ end
end
context 'view merge request with external CI service' do